More than 50 years ago, when broth- ers Chris and John Vardouniotis came to America from Greece, they worked and struggled to learn whatever needed to go into the restaurant business ... It finally happened when opening their first restaurant on the Wayne State University campus in Detroit, which was to be the springboard to bigger things. The year 2009 is the 33rd anniver- sary in a result of that launch pad when Mama Mia Italian Pizzeria Restaurant, now known as Mama Mia Italian Cuisine, opened on Beech-Daly, just south of Grand River, Redford ... Since that day in 1976, more than 2 million people have come through its doors ... The allegiance of that many customers throughout its 33- year existence could not be wrong. It started out and still is a much respect- ed family restaurant ... Chris and Helen's son Michael, and son-in-law Jimmy Papaionou, married to their daughter Katrina, assist Chris in operating Mama Mia Italian Cuisine, Redford ... When not in school, their 19-year-old grandson, Ari Papaionou, is in training to also be of assistance ... Helen at one time was its bartender and helper where needed. Mama Mia, Redford, originally seated only 90 persons ... The capacity today is 140, plus six stools at an intimate and well-stocked bar ... Booths and tables are casually placed for relaxation and comfort, with one wall com- pletely mirrored, above an end- to-end length of booths The food has changed little ... Chris, being from the old school of restaurant dining, is a stickler on cuisine having a touch of yesteryears in its prep- arations ... An Italian pizzeria, he feels, should have a certain quality that will appeal to all members in family togetherness. Bestsellers are, of course, the pizza, tossed in the Mama iia, Redford, kitchen and strewn plentifully with requested ingredients, and salads ... But the steaks, chops and Italian specialties are all on the restaurant's high called-for list ... With the insistence of quality ingredients comes the upholding of low prices ... Like 14- ounce N.Y. sirloin, S17.95; 8-oz. steer filet, S17.95, both with mushrooms and onion rings; garlic-seasoned sliced tenderloin with mushrooms and green peppers, S14.50; tender St. Louis spare ribs, S11.95, short ends, $11.55 long ends, whole slab for two, 518.95; veal marsala, veal cac- ciatore and veal picante, S14.95; etc. ... all served with house-made soup or salad, potato or pasta and breadbasket. NATIONWIDE ACCOLADES endors- ing Buddy's Pizza and Tomatoes Apizza as among America's best comes from GQ (Gentlemen's Quarterly) magazine, by - writer, elan Richman. Buddy's (cheese pizza) ranked No. 15 among and beating out an impressive list from Chicago, Boston, New York, San Francisco, Philadelphia, Los Angeles, etc. ... "Buddy's crust is one of the best in America': writes Richman. "The interior slices on a Buddy's pizza are light, slightly crunchy and extremely satisfying." Tomatoes Apizza, Farmington Hills, (pepperoni pie) was graded No. 21 by Richman, who wrote, "The non-Sicilian crust was soft, slightly charred, and entire- ly appealing, the tomato sauce and cheese more than satisfactory." Two others in the Detroit area graded by Richman were Luigi's, Harrison Township, (gourmet veggie pizza), No. 13, and Niki's, Detroit (cheese pizza with feta), No. 24.
